Trader consensus reflects a razor-tight Liga Nacional Clausura playoff quarterfinal first leg at Estadio Marquesa de la Ensenada, where league-leading CSD Xelajú MC faces resilient CD Marquense on even footing. Xelajú tops the table with 27 points from solid recent draws but contends away against Marquense's strong home record, including a 1-0 league win over Xelajú on April 1. Head-to-head history is competitive—Xelajú's 4-2 February victory offset by Marquense's edge in recent home clashes—while Xelajú grapples with injuries to centre-back Gerardo Gordillo (knee) and winger Yilton Díaz (leg), potentially neutralizing their attack. No major lineup changes reported in the last 48 hours, heightening uncertainty in this high-stakes aggregate tie opener.
